HM-SNT Turbidity and Suspended Solids Meter

I. Product Description

The HM-SNT turbidity and suspended solids meter is a portable water quality instrument designed for the rapid determination of turbidity and suspended solids in water and transparent liquids. Using the turbidimetric method, it measures the degree of light scattering caused by insoluble particulate matter suspended in the sample and quantitatively characterizes the concentration of these suspended particles. The instrument provides simultaneous measurement of both turbidity and suspended solids parameters, eliminating the need for separate devices when dual-parameter data is required.

Q2: How does the turbidimetric method differ from the nephelometric method for turbidity measurement?

A: The turbidimetric method measures the attenuation of a light beam passing through the sample — essentially the decrease in transmitted light intensity caused by suspended particles. The nephelometric method measures the intensity of light scattered at a 90-degree angle to the incident beam. The HM-SNT employs the turbidimetric method in compliance with GB13200-91, which is well-suited for the measurement ranges and applications specified for this instrument.
